기타언어초록

Strain HY701 was isolated from human feces for probiotic use by selecting highly resistant isolates to artificial gastric acid and bile acid. Strain HY701 was identified as Lactobacillus reuteri using 16S rDNA sequencing, and tentatively named L. reuteri HY701. The resistance of L. reuteri HY701 to artificial gastric acid (PH 2.5) was high with a survival rate of over 90%. L. reuteri HY701 also showed high tolerance to artificial bile acid after incubation in artificial gastric acid. Using the API ZYM test kit, the carcinogenic enzymes (${eta}$-glucuronidase and (${eta}$-glucosidase were not detected with L. reuteri HY70l, while the beneficial enzyme (${eta}$-galactosidase was weakly detected. L. reuteri HY701 was sensitive to $100;{mu}g/mL$ nisin, $20;{mu}g/mL$ roxithromycin, $15;{mu}g/mL$ erythromycin, but resistant to $20;{mu}g/mL$ streptomycin, $10;{mu}g/mL$ tetracycline, $20;{mu}g/mL$ ciprofloxacin, $20;{mu}g/mL$ nystatin, $20;{mu}g/mL$ gentamycin, $10;{mu}g/mL$ doxycycline, $10;{mu}g/mL$ chloramphenicol, and $20;{mu}g/mL$ ampicillin. L. reuteri HY701 was shown to possess bactericidal activity as it inhibited the growth of Listeria monocytogenes ATCC 19111 and Escherichia coli JM109 completely within 24 hr of incubation. These results indicate that L. reuteri HY701 could be used as a probiotic strain.
